Symbolics: A Deep Dive into Symbolism and Meaning
Symbolics is the study and interpretation of symbols, which are representations that carry deeper meanings beyond their literal sense. Symbols can be found in various forms such as language, art, religion, and culture, playing a significant role in communication and understanding.
The Power of Symbols
Symbols have the power to transcend language barriers and convey complex ideas in a simple, visual form. They can evoke strong emotions, trigger memories, and communicate universal truths that resonate with people across different backgrounds.
Symbolism in Different Cultures
Symbolism varies across different cultures and can hold diverse meanings depending on the context in which they are used. For example, the color red can symbolize love and passion in Western cultures, while it represents luck and prosperity in Chinese culture.
The Role of Symbols in Art and Literature
Symbols are commonly used in art and literature to add layers of meaning to a piece of work. For instance, a dove symbolizes peace, a rose symbolizes love, and a skull symbolizes mortality. These symbols enhance the depth and complexity of the work, inviting readers or viewers to interpret them on a deeper level.
The Psychology of Symbols
Psychologists study how symbols impact our cognition and behavior. The Swiss psychologist Carl Jung believed that symbols are a natural expression of the unconscious mind and that analyzing them can provide insight into an individual's psyche.
